Share Timers
There are two sharing paths: a public web timer link for anyone with the URL, and studio sharing for instructors inside the same studio workspace.

Public web links
The Share action creates a web URL for the current routine. The URL opens in a browser and can also open Reform Cue on iPhone for import.
Use public links for handoff, testing, or distributing a specific class plan to someone who is not in your studio workspace.
- 1Open a routine card or detail view.
- 2Tap Share.
- 3Wait for the link to publish.
- 4Send the URL through the iOS share sheet.
Opening a shared routine on iPhone
Open the shared link on iPhone to import the routine into Reform Cue.
After import, review the name, folder, springs, and notes before teaching if the source routine needs studio-specific changes.
Public link versus studio sharing
A public share link can be opened by anyone who receives the URL.
Studio sharing is for instructors in the same studio workspace. Use it when the routine should live in the studio library instead of being sent around as a public link.
Studio sharing
If you belong to an active studio workspace, a routine can be marked Studio. Studio routines appear in the shared studio routine library for eligible instructors.
Making the routine Private removes your studio share. You can also share or privatize an entire folder from the folder context menu.
Studio routine and move links require the recipient to be signed in and joined to the studio.
